Originally Posted by 03lances
Ok so I have read that you can use a stock or aftermarket evo downpipe that just needs lengthen by a foot. Now would it make more sense if I am getting another exhaust setup to leave the downpipe as is and bring the exhaust to it?
Neither. They both end in flanges. All you need to do is lengthen your test pipe or cut the flange off your cat and lengthen it with a small section of pipe and weld another flange on the end.

Originally Posted by 03lances
Ok so next up lol. I am looking at injectors and having a heck of a time finding some. I have someone offering me some 2g injectors but I dont know what these are or if they will even work anyone know?
2G Eclipse injectors won't work. They are the low impedance. WRX 440's are easily found on ebay or over at the NASIOC forums.
